6630 is a smartphone, it is capable of having installed applications, however, it is also prone to viruses that travels via bluetooth...

s700 is a non-smartphone, you can only install a few java applications, but unlike the two phones, it has a better camera lens (CCD sensor) and better build quality...

k750 is also a non-smartphone. but it boasts of a 2MP picture size (1632x1224) with autofocus! being the newest among the three, it may have some software bugs, but that's where occasional firmware updates come in...

for most users, k750 is the choice, but for me, i will choose the s700, because of its build quality, unique looks, and scratch-resistant screen...

i'm using a k700 as of the moment, but i plan to upgrade to an s700 in the next few weeks.

as for the camera difference, the s700 can take pictures with a maximum resolution of 1280x960 pixels (that translates to 1228800 pixels, or 1.3 MegaPixels if rounded off), while the k750 can take pictures with a maximum resolution of 1632x1224 pixels (that translates to 1997568 pixels, or 2.0 MegaPixels if rounded off). in reading other people's opinions, most of them say that the k750's camera beats off the s700.

i've already tried both phones, although i recommend the k750 to other people because it is newer and it has better features (the s700 has similar features like the k700, with the exception of a better camera, better screen, and expandable memory slot), my heart belongs to the s700. that huge screen is something i can't ignore, although the UI (User Interface) of the s700 is slower than the k750...
